Nature & Wildlives nearby 21 Princes Avenue, London N3 2DA, United Kingdom



Victoria Park

Approximately 0.38 km away
Address: London, United Kingdom

Stephens House & Gardens

Approximately 0.67 km away
Address: 17 East End Road, London N3 3QE, United Kingdom

Highgate Cricket Club

Approximately 0.67 km away
Address: London, United Kingdom

Long Lane Pasture

Approximately 0.81 km away
Address: London N3 2RU, United Kingdom

Glebelands Open Space

Approximately 1.11 km away
Address: London N2 9AA, United Kingdom

Creative Garden Solutions

Approximately 1.22 km away
Address: 2 Bouchier House, Oak Lane, East Finchley, London N2 8NH, United Kingdom

Riverside Walk

Approximately 1.24 km away
Address: London, United Kingdom

Glebelands Wood Nature Reserve

Approximately 1.41 km away
Address: London, United Kingdom

The Secret Garden Company

Approximately 1.52 km away
Address: 9 Castle Road, London N12 9EE, United Kingdom

Windsor Open Space

Approximately 1.56 km away
Address: London, United Kingdom

Charter Green

Approximately 1.6 km away
Address: London, United Kingdom

Old Finchleians Memorial Ground

Approximately 1.76 km away
Address: London, United Kingdom

Chalgrove Gardens

Approximately 1.84 km away
Address: London, United Kingdom

Northway Gardens

Approximately 1.88 km away
Address: London, United Kingdom

The Woodside Park Sports and Social Club

Approximately 1.89 km away
Address: Southover, London N12 7JG, United Kingdom